Is Birdie really that bad?

Yes! ...No! Alpha 2 is a tremendously well balanced game, and Birdie isn't so bad as he is polarizing. If you aren't building meter for his win condition CC, you're likely losing. Players familiar with the matchup wont hesitate to defuse Birdie's offense. If you're scared, Birdie wins- Quite a simple concept.

Essentially, Birdie gets one chance per round to run his sh*t. A perfect tournament character.

Loads of pokes and specials end Birdie's turn. Like Sagat, some of his bigger normals are punishable on hit. Unlike Sagat Birdie needs charge for his special cancels, limiting their utility.

SFA2 Framedata Glossary
Damage

Units of base damage inflicted by the move (100% life bar = 144 units of health). Most moves have a damage range; the number inside the square brackets indicates which Random Damage Table the move uses to look up any additional damage and the % chance of doing so.

Stun

Units of stun inflicted by the move.

Startup

The frame the move hits on (1st active frame). Super moves with a screen freeze will separate pre- and post-screen freeze startup frames by a '+' (Ex: 5+0).

Active

The portion of a move that can hit. How many frames a move remains active for. ()=Inactive frames in-between active frames. [xN]=Repeated sequences.

Frame Adv

The frame advantage values when the attack is blocked. (Add +1 frame to all OnBlockAdv values for the move's OnHitAdv value; Ex: +2oB/+3oH, -4oB/-3oH)

Meter

The units of meter gained on whiff/block/hit. (48, 96, and 144 units of meter are required for 1, 2, and 3 bars of meter respectively)

Block

Low attacks must be blocked crouching. High attacks must be blocked standing. Mid attacks can be blocked either way.

Properties
  • Chain Cancel: Can be canceled into itself or another normal attack.
  • Special Cancel: Can be canceled into a special attack.
  • Super Cancel: Can be canceled into a super attack.
  • Throw/Air-Throw: A normal throw or command grab.
  • Soft Knockdown: Will knockdown, but opponent can quick rise or roll.
  • Hard Knockdown: Will knockdown, opponent cannot quick rise or roll.
  • Projectile: Produces a projectile (i.g. Hadoken).
  • Proj. Reflect: Will reflect an opponent's projectile back at them.
  • Proj. Absorb: Will absorb an opponent's projectile.
  • Invuln. Startup: Has frames at the start that are completely invincible.
  • Invuln. Lower: Has frames that are invincible to lower attacks.
  • Invuln. Upper: Has frames that are invincible to mid/higher attacks (aka low profile).
  • Counterhit: Deals and/or takes more damage when counter hit.
Frames

All framedata collected with the game speed set to normal, where the game tickrate and framerate are the same(60fps).

Speed

All framedata collected with the game speed set to normal.

Hitboxes

All hitbox images have the character standing/jumping in the exact same position, so hitbox distances can be easily compared.

  • Blue: Hurtbox - hittable area of a character.
  • Red: Hitbox - attacking area of an action.
  • Yellow: Throwbox - throwing area of an action.
  • Green: Pushbox - collidable area of a character.
  • White: Axis - core of a character from which all other boxes reference.
  • Pink: Projectile Hitbox - attacking area of a projectile.
  • Light Blue: Projectile Hurtbox - hittable area of a projectile.
  • Purple: Counterbox - hittable area that triggers a counter attack.

Bull Horn
(hold)P.pngP.png/K.pngK.png(then release)

A2 Birdie BullHorn 1.png
A2 Birdie BullHorn 2.png
A2 Birdie BullHorn 3.png
A2 Birdie BullHorn 4.png
A2 Birdie BullHorn 5.png
Version Damage Stun Startup Active Frame Adv Meter Block Properties
Lp.pngMp.png/Lk.pngMk.png Level 1: 7[7]
Level 2: 13[7]
Level 3: 18[8]
Level 4: 26[8]
FINAL: 33[12]
Level 1: 8
Level 2: 10
Level 3: 12
Level 4: 15
FINAL: 20
26-29 6 -5 at worst
0 at best
2/3/4 Mid.png Startupinv.png
Upperbodyinv.png
Lp.pngHp.png/Lk.pngHk.png Same as Lp.pngMp.png/Lk.pngMk.png version. Same as Lp.pngMp.png/Lk.pngMk.png version. 26-38 6 -5 at worst
0 at best
2/3/4 Mid.png Startupinv.png
Upperbodyinv.png
Mp.pngHp.png/Mk.pngHk.png Same as Lp.pngMp.png/Lk.pngMk.png version. Same as Lp.pngMp.png/Lk.pngMk.png version. 26-44 6 -5 at worst
0 at best
2/3/4 Mid.png Startupinv.png
Upperbodyinv.png
3p.png/3p.png Same as Lp.pngMp.png/Lk.pngMk.png version. Same as Lp.pngMp.png/Lk.pngMk.png version. 26-60 6 -5 at worst
0 at best
2/3/4 Mid.png Startupinv.png
Upperbodyinv.png
  • 7 frames of startup invul.; followed by 16 frames of upper body invul.

Charge times:

  • Level 1 = 32 frames (~1/2 second)
  • Level 2 = 121 frames (~2 seconds)
  • Level 3 = 241 frames (~4 seconds)
  • Level 4 = 481 frames (~8 seconds)
  • FINAL = 961 frames (~16 seconds)

The attack will do more damage the longer you hold the buttons. Very useful. You can have up to 4 of these when all buttons are held down. It can be punished by CC on block if poorly spaced but even then it's a 1 frame punish. This move has virtually no lag and can be used to get close after a knockdown or set up grabs or super. It even anti-airs when released right. If you have this move charged and the opponent does a CC, release all buttons to make them whiff, then the headbutt will hit.

Advanced Strategy


Use crouching Mk.png to bait out turns and punish them with light bullhead.

Use your tick setups such as light kicks to force 50/50's or bait out CC's.

If they somehow get hit by a final at the end of a blocked CC, you may continue the combo post cc with crouching heavy punch and light bullhead.

Bullhorn is a true reversal for a few frames so it can be used to counter specific ac's (Rose punch ac for example), pokes, and command throws.

Punish AC happy opponents with command grab or empty jump or walk in CC.

Kick AC leaves the opponent standing so after a close kick AC you can try to follow up with a Valle CC if they are still standing.

A2 Icon Dhalsim.png Vs. Dhalsim: 7-3 Birdie's favor

Extreme zoning and high priority buttons make this matchup very hard but the hardest thing about this matchup is Sims teleport. It completely removes Birdies sweep starter final custom and allows him out corners and continue zoning, Sims very slow and high jump arc is also extremely hard to reach him or air to air him due to birdies very low jump arc, Sims back medium punch is also a hard button for Birdie to handle. Winning this requires a careful get in and good use of supers as your custom is not nearly as powerful or useful in this matchup, and good usage of light bullhead to challenge his fullscreen pokes.

A2 Icon Rolento.png Vs. Rolento: 4-6 Rolento's favor

Extremely uphill due to the knifes and the sheer amount of zoning he can do with him bouncing around the screen. Risk and reward is never in your favor as Rolento's custom is on par with Birdie's. Close and far Bull Revengers and extremely risky long range bullheads are required to win this, standing and crouching Mp.png are used to punch out the knifes but jumping Lp.png and jumping Mk.png can be used at very specific angles. Standing back to build some meter during the zoning is also advised as your going to need as much as you can get.

A2 Icon Rose.png Vs. Rose: 4-6 Rose's favor

This one can be hard but it is still very winnable. You have to play more slow and reactionary against Rose, try to snipe out the recovery of her st.Hk.png with CC and catch mashed cr.Mp.png with Bull Revenger. Punish normal drills on block with CC and install drills in the corner with lvl 2 or lvl 3 The Birdie super (a punish not many characters have). Her fireballs have very slow recovery making it an easy Bull Revenger punish or a good jump in window. You can fight her good and far range sweep with some of your own crouching buttons such as cr.Mp.png and cr.Lk.png. Birdie can also counter her infamous Punch AC with his Bullhorn and can fight Rose players looking for it too much easily with just his command throw. Your best jump in attack is dj.Lk.png but jumping in without meter is not advised as dj.Lk.png is not 100% consistent against her cr.Hp.png and for her cr.Hp.png into her anti-air throw can hurt alot it's best to mostly jump in with meter so the situation is more scary for her.

A2 Icon Zangief.png Vs. Zangief: 6-4 Birdie's favor

Pretty wacky matchup here. Both characters have top tier level air buttons but Birdie will usually win out in the air-to-air game with his neutral jump buttons and just in general jumping heavy and light punch. Now when it comes to fighting his magic throw and tic throws you have Bullhorn (Zangief can counter this with a ballsy 360k) as well as your CC. ALWAYS BE CHARGING BULLHORN, at very close ranges it can be punished on hit with a 360 but there are plenty of times where it will knock him back too far and with a held final even if it is punished with 360 its a net gain in your favor not to mention that if he is anywhere near stun it will stun him. When you land a jump in and go for the throw/CC mixup. Zangief has a consistent way to get out of that with lariat, many Zangiefs and trigger happy with this just wait for it and punish with CC or Bullhead. Due to his slow jump in and fat hurtbox AA CC is also a much easier technique in this matchup.
